Cornwall Partnership NHS Foundation Trust are looking for a Specialty Doctor to be based in the child and adolescent mental health service inpatient unit ( Sowenna) on the Bodmin Community Hospital Site. The role will be vacant from the 5th August 2025 and the incumbent will be an integral part of the medical team at Sowenna, as well as working within the broader MDT.

The primary responsibility is, under the supervision of the Consultant, to lead on the psychiatric assessment and management of child & adolescent inpatients admitted to the Sowenna Unit.

The ideal candidate will have experience working with Children and young persons in an inpatient unit and have worked across other mental health services including primary care services.

The successful candidate would have opportunity to complete higher training opportunities and be provided support with Exams.

Main duties of the job

The primary responsibility of the Speciality Doctor is to:

* Carry out the psychiatric assessment, diagnosis and development of an initial treatment plan for the inpatients on, with weekly review of such treatment plans.
* Conduct initial reviews of all new patients (in conjunction with them being clerked in by the ward doctor), obtaining the developmental history for the patients / carers, develop and outline an appropriate treatment plan and weekly review or more if needed.
* Take a leading role in co-ordinating and chairing clinical CPA meetings. Again close supervision will be on hand with ample scope for the candidate to develop confidence in the clinical, management and clinical skills required to do this task.
* Provide supervision to the Sowenna Junior Clinical Fellow.
* Work closely with the MDT, in triaging referrals. This will involve overviewing Form One's (referral's), obtaining additional information as needed and forming an initial opinion on the appropriateness or otherwise of admission.
* Ensure relevant actions from the ward round are completed and accurate liaison with patient, parent / carers and community teams are in place.

We're an NHS community and mental health provider Trust based in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ly. We deliver community and hospital-based care to improve people's physical and mental health. We also provide specialist support to people with dementia or a learning disability.

We are a people organisation and people matter to us. As part of the team, you'll help support the health and wellbeing of the people who live and visit this beautiful part of the UK.

Over 4,000 people make up the Trust. This includes doctors, nurses, therapists, plus admin and support staff.

We work in people's homes, in community clinics and bases. Some staff work from one of our 13 community hospitals. Our aspiration is to have great people, provide great care, be a great place to work and a great partner.

Approximately 568,000 people live here. A third of people who live in Cornwall are supported by acute hospital services in Devon. As a result, we also work closely with our partners in Devon. In the summer, and during other holidays lots of people choose to visit the area. This increases the numbers of people who use our services.
